Output 4143957214a83eae9d933b61d1c7c1019e962cb7fe7a483fb25b7034c2bfb867:1

value
10074967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f65398f29ec5575f437f6fa53c6189b6c955b13 OP_EQUAL
address
37UDkrW997HVp5ZEb4EHQjnQX9sJgxXUZG
transaction
4143957214a83eae9d933b61d1c7c1019e962cb7fe7a483fb25b7034c2bfb867
spent
true